The phrase "addressing the diffusion of"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when discussing the act of dealing with or tackling the spread or distribution of something, such as information, technology, or ideas.
Example: "The conference focused on addressing the diffusion of renewable energy technologies across developing countries."
Alternatives: "tackling the spread of" or "dealing with the distribution of".
